The Cyber Security Senior Manager conducts risk and security assessment activities with our customer, including analyses of customer environments, assessment of their current state of security and level of preparedness to protect their services and data and recommendations to address any gaps determined.
This critical position partners with security architects/engineers, and various program management areas to create cybersecurity recommendations, response plans, and direction for the customer(s).
Lead and execute strategic cybersecurity engagements
Serve as a trusted advisor to customers translating complex cybersecurity concepts into actionable business insights
Executing cloud and network security assessments
Regularly perform or assist with performing gap assessments against known cybersecurity frameworks (NIST, PCI, CIS, etc.)
Conduct internal configuration and vulnerability assessments of information systems using commercial and open-source assessment tools
Document and analyze system configurations and provide recommendations on best practices
Stay current with emerging threats, technologies, and regulatory requirements to guide customers effectively
Create detailed, professional documentation / reports that clearly communicate vulnerabilities, mitigation strategies, and remediation steps
